10-Step Korean Skincare Routine For Glowing Skin

Everyone wants to know all about the 10-Step Korean Skincare routine! How about we customize one for glowing skin results? Read on to find out exactly how.

Korean Skincare is trending all over the world and it’s an obsession of having a glowing and healthy skin. But achieving this is not a cakewalk and one has to follow to lot of steps.

Basically, Korean skin care is all about using gentle & barrier repairing products in an extensive way. It focuses on prevention and protection rather than the use of products to undo damage.

Not only does this type of routine often produce effective and consistent results, but it also contributes to people respecting their skin and taking a little extra “me time.” While many people begin with a 10-step routine, you can adjust up or down, depending on your needs or preference.

STEP 1: OIL BASED CLEANSER

The most popular Korean skincare trend is double cleansing, it involves cleansing your face with two cleansers. This technique not only helps remove impurities and grime from your skin; it does so very gently.
Massage an oil-based cleanser in circular motions for 30 seconds, emulsify it with some water and massage again. Now rinse it with plain water.

STEP 2: WATER-BASED CLEANSER

Use a non-stripping and PH Balanced face wash as a second step to make sure that your skin is all clear. Korean Skincare focuses on PH balanced & non stripping face wash in order to get a cleansed yet hydrated skin.

STEP 3: EXFOLIANT

Now comes my most favorite part, ‘Chemical Exfoliation’. It is a gentle way to achieve a smoother looking skin Moreover it helps with pigmentation, scarring, blackheads & whiteheads.

Take 3-4 drops on a cotton pad or your palm (cotton pad is recommend for beginners & sensitive skin) and swipe it all over face and neck, it really works magic. Once or twice a week at night is good enough. If you have sensitive skin, it’s beneficial to exfoliate only once a week.

STEP 4: TONER

Toners help in prepping up the skin before getting into heavy skincare products. Think of your skin as a sponge, Wet sponge absorbs more water. Likewise, your skincare penetrates better when the skin is damp. STEP 5: ESSENCE

Essence is light weight, packed with anti-ageing, hydrating and complexion enhancing ingredients. They are more potent and helps on targeting the skin concerns. It’s not mandatory to use an essence, I usually alternate between a serum or an essence at night.

STEP 7: SHEET MASK

Sheet masks are filled with an essence and a prolonged contact with the skin transfers the needed nutrients and moisture to the skin. It helps with dry and dehydrated skin although there are many targeted sheet masks available in the market but the key role is to hydrate the skin deeply.
Take out the sheet mask, put it on your face for 10-15 minutes and then remove it. I like to squeeze the remaining essence out from the sheet and apply it on hands and neck to avoid any wastage. My favorite is the Axis-Y 61% Mugwort Green Vital Energy Complex Sheet Mask.

STEP 8: EYE CREAM

Skin around the eyes is the thinnest and the most sensitive so it needs an utmost care. Although I have personally experienced that not every eye cream works for dark circles but they do provide a nourishment and helps with fine lines or wrinkles. Just take out a little eye cream and Massage it around your eyes using your Ring finger to eliminate any excess pressure. STEP 9: MOISTURIZER

A skincare routine is incomplete without a moisturizer as it seals everything into the skin and hydrates it. You should introduce a moisturizer into your skincare routine at the earliest, even if your skin is oily

STEP 10: SUNSCREEN

Wearing sunscreen is one of the best and easiest ways to protect your skin’s appearance and health at any age. Used regularly, sunscreen helps prevent sunburn, skin cancer and premature ageing and as we all know, Protection is better than cure any day.
Also, follow the ‘three finger rule’ to apply a sunscreen just to make sure that your skin is fully protected and reapply it after two-three hours before stepping out in sun.
